/**
* Registers the `logging/setLevel` request handler with the MCP server.
*
* This handler allows MCP clients to dynamically adjust the server's minimum
* log level. When a client sends a `logging/setLevel` request, the server will:
* 1. Validate the requested level (via Zod schema)
* 2. Update the internal logger's minimum level
* 3. Return an empty result to acknowledge the change
*
* Per the MCP specification, the server must respond with an empty result
* object upon successful configuration.
*
* Supported log levels (per RFC 5424 syslog severity):
* - debug, info, notice, warning, error, critical, alert, emergency
*
* @param server - The McpServer instance to attach the handler to
*
* @example
* ```typescript
* const server = new McpServer({ name: "my-server", version: "1.0.0" });
* registerLoggingSetLevelHandler(server);
* await server.connect(transport);
* ```
*/
